Founded in 1990 and based in New Richmond, WI, Isometric's vision was to manufacture tooling and provide manufacturing solutions to exacting specifications for ultra-small, ultra-precise, and ultra-complex applications. For the past 36 years, we're proud to say we've grown to be one of the largest medical-focused micro molders in the United States. In March 2024, Isometric was acquired by Nissha Medical Technologies (NMT), a global Contract Design/Development Manufacturing Organization. NMT’s expertise in the design and development of endoscopic devices, combined with Isometric’s micro-molding capabilities, have the potential to redefine the realm of minimally invasive surgical instruments and surgical robotics. Together, we aim to address the changing demands of medical devices by enhancing component miniaturization and improving the maneuverability of small and precision components, ultimately advancing medical efficiency. 

 

It's an exciting time to join our team, and we're hiring for a 1st shift CNC Milling Specialist. This role is responsible for the set-up and operation of high precision CNC vertical milling machines to take materials from set up to completion in producing steel components and electrodes for manufacturing micro precision plastic injection molds. The hours for this position are Monday-Friday, 7:00AM-3:30PM. 

 

Essential Functions and Responsibilities:

  • Set up, operate, and understand the use of hand tools, grinding machinery, milling machinery, drill presses, band saw, measuring devices, micrometers, caliper to cut, grind, drill and take material from setup to completion.
  • Work to tolerances of +/- .0001.
  • Review blueprints, analyze and troubleshoot problems.
  • Performs repair work by planning and troubleshooting.
  • Perform mathematics and geometric functions and possess mechanical aptitude.
  • Arrange layout of tooling, material and other related components to record final inspection results.
  • Required to operate semi-complex CAD and CAM software.
  • Performs all duties in a safe manner, complying with safety rules.
  • Maintains tools and equipment; lubricate and make minor adjustments and repairs as necessary and according to periodic maintenance schedule.
  • Maintains safe and clean (dust free) workstation.
  • Other duties as assigned.

 

Education and/or Experience:

  • Graduate of Accredited Machine Tooling program
  • Knowledge and experience with CAD and CAM programming software preferred
  • Education and experience in reading blueprints, sketches, drawings, manuals, specifications or sample parts to determine dimensions and tolerances of finished work, sequence of operations and setup requirements.
  • Experience with set up and operation of all tool room equipment.
  • Experience in the usage of measurement tools and instruments
